Career Overview
Lamar Odom declared for the 1999 NBA draft and was selected by the Los Angeles Clippers as the fourth overall pick. Odom became a star player and was named to the 2000 NBA All-Rookie First Team. In the 2000-01 season, he scored an average of 17 points per game and started 74 games.
Unfortunately, Odom was suspended for five games that season for violating the NBA’s anti-drug policy. The following season, he was suspended once again on another anti-drug violation after admitting to using marijuana. Despite these initial setbacks, Lamar Odom’s skills helped him become one of the wealthiest NBA players in the world and an NBA legend.
The Heat & The Lakers
Lamar Odom joined the Miami Heat in 2003 and helped his new team become the fourth seed in the playoffs. While Odom had a solid year with the Heat, he was traded for Shaquille O’Neal to the Los Angeles Lakers once the season ended.
During his first season with the Lakers, Odom suffered a shoulder injury which forced him to miss the end of the 2004-05 season. By the end of the following season, after a rocky start, Odom started to hit his stride, scoring consecutive triple-doubles.
Unfortunately, more injuries limited him to only 56 games during the 2006-07 season, though Odom returned in 2007 to try and make up for lost time. However, following a lackluster showing at training camp, Odom was benched until later in the 2008 season.
He had a standout performance in February 2009, scoring 15 points to help the Lakers defeat Cleveland. Soon after, Odom won his first NBA championship after the Lakers beat the Orlando Magic during the 2009 NBA Finals.
The Mavericks & The Clippers
During his final season with the Lakers, Lamar Odom won the NBA Sixth Man of the Year Award before being traded to the Dallas Mavericks in 2011. However, Odom struggled often in Dallas, and his relationship with the team didn’t last long. Ultimately, he left the team in early 2012. Later, it was revealed that an argument with Mavericks’ owner, Mark Cuban, had been the deciding factor in Odom’s exit.
Lamar Odom returned to the Clippers in June 2012 and played in all 82 games for the third time. With his help, the Clippers won their first-ever Pacific Division title, fishing 56-26. In July 2012, Odom became a free agent, and while the Clippers considered re-signing him, they decided to commit to other players instead.
Odom’s Other Ventures
After leaving the Clippers, Lamar Odom signed with Laboral Kutxa Baskonia in the Spanish and Euroleagues. However, he played in only two games before a back injury benched him, and he signed up with the New York Knicks in 2014.
In 2018, Lamar joined Mighty Sports and, the following year, became captain of the Enemies squad in the 3×3 basketball league. Odom tried his hand at boxing in 2021, engaging singer Aaron Carter in an exhibition match before fighting Ojani Noa.

In 1999, Lamar Odom signed his first NBA contract, worth $11.4 million, with the Los Angeles Clippers. Odom was just 20 years old when he joined the NBA, and his starting annual salary with the Clippers was $2.4 million.
Lamar’s salary reached $3.5 million annually before signing a new contract with the Miami Heat. The 6-year contract was worth $71.7 million starting in the 03/04 season. After just one year under the agreement, Odom was traded from the Heat to the LA Lakers. By this time, Lamar Odom’s annual salary ranged between $11.5 and $14.1 million.
Odom later signed a four-year contract worth $32.8 million with the Lakers from 2009 to 2013. Only two of the four years were spent playing with the Lakers before he transferred to the Mavericks in 2011 and briefly returned to the Clippers in 2012.
Lamar Odom finished his NBA career with the New York Knicks before retiring in 2014. He earned more than $93 million throughout his professional career.
